What you will do:
Perform disassembly, repair, or replacement of parts and/or production equipment Conduct fitting and alignment of mechanical components for proper functioning Utilize troubleshooting techniques to provide temporary and long-term fixes to minimize downtime Diagnose and correct maintenance issues on Statement and Invoices Equipment, Mail Inserters, Cut Sheet Printers and Laser Printers Analyze and interpret schematic diagrams for electronic troubleshooting What you will need to have: A high school diploma or GED required 3+ years of progressive maintenance repair and electronic/mechanical troubleshooting Willing to go back to school to earn degree or certification Mechanical aptitude Experience using a computer for data entry Experience with using hand tools like drill, screwdriver, and soldering equipment What would be great to have: Associate degree in Electronic Technology, Industrial Maintenance, or Mechatronics or equivalent Military training and background 5+ years of production maintenance with electronic repair experience Experience withIP5000, HP
Roll-to-Roll printer, Ricoh Cut Sheet Printers Experience with BlueCrest, APS, MPS, and EPIC inserting equipment Experience with APEX or Criterion sorters Important information about this role: You will work the following schedule and hours:1st shift- 6:30 am to 3:00 pm; 2nd shift
